Description

Well presented two bedroom ground floor flat offered with no onward chain and realistically priced for a quick sale.
This attractive property benefits from a modern fitted kitchen and contemporary bathroom, providing comfortable and convenient living throughout. Externally, the flat offers an allocated parking bay to the front along with the added advantage of a garage to the rear.
Ideally situated close to Westcliff Train Station, the property is perfect for commuters and also offers easy access to Southend seafront, local amenities, shops, and leisure facilities.

Accommodation Comprises

Security intercom. Communal door to the side aspect gives access to communal entrance hall. Six panelled door gives access to flat.

Entrance Hall

Opaque glass window to the side aspect. Textured ceiling. Single banked radiator. Security entry phone. Airing cupboard housing hot water tank. Wall mounted fuse board with trip switch. Fitted storage cupboard housing gas meter and central heating boiler. Doors leading to rooms:

Lounge

14' 7" x 11' 10" (4.45m x 3.6m)

Upvc double glazed window to the rear aspect. Textured ceiling. Single banked radiator. Television aerial point. Telephone point.

Kitchen

10' 0" x 7' 5" (3.05m x 2.26m)

Upvc double glazed window to the front aspect. The kitchen has been recently fitted with a range of base units with roll edge work surfaces incorporating a stainless steel single drainer sink unit with mixer tap. Further matching wall mounted storage units. Integrated four ring ceramic hob and oven with extractor fan over. Space and plumbing for washing machine. Space for fridge/freezer. Part tiling to walls. Vinyl wood effect flooring.

Bathroom

Opaque upvc double glazed window to the rear aspect. Fitted with a modern white three piece suite comprising of low level w.c, vanity wash hand basin with cupboard under and panelled enclosed bath with mixer tap and wall mounted shower attachment plus shower screen. Part tiling to walls. Vinyl wood effect flooring. Single banked radiator. Textured ceiling.

Bedroom One

13' 5" x 9' 6" (4.1m x 2.9m)

Upvc double glazed window to the front aspect. Textured ceiling. Single banked radiator. Range of fitted bedroom furniture comprising wardrobe and matching overhead storage cupboards.

Bedroom Two

13' 2" x 8' 7" (4.01m x 2.62m)

Upvc double glazed window to the side aspect. Smooth plastered ceiling. Single banked radiator. Fitted wardrobes.

Exterior

The property benefits from having an allocated parking space situated at the front of the flat and also a Garage situated to the rear of the block where there is also a hardstanding patio for a potential seating area.
